What is the cheapest month to fly from Vancouver Intl Airport to Sapporo Chitose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Vancouver Intl Airport to Sapporo Chitose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Vancouver Intl Airport to Sapporo Chitose Airport is January, where tickets cost C$ 1,110 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and June,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is C$ 1,914 and C$ 1,885 respectively.

FAQs for booking Vancouver to Sapporo flights

  • What is the cheapest flight from Vancouver Intl Airport to Sapporo Chitose Airport?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Vancouver Intl Airport to Sapporo Chitose Airport was C$ 561 for a one-way ticket and C$ 822 for a round-trip.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Vancouver to Sapporo?

    On your way to Sapporo, you’ll fly out from Vancouver Intl. You’ll be landing at Sapporo Chitose.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Vancouver to Sapporo?

    Only Air Canada offers inflight Wi-Fi service on the Vancouver to Sapporo fl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Vancouver to Sapporo?

    The Boeing 787-8 Dreamliner is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Vancouver to Sapporo fl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Vancouver to Sapporo?

    oneworld, and Star Alliance are the airline alliances operating flights between Vancouver and Sapporo, with oneworld being the most commonly used for this route.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Vancouver to Sapporo, ANA or EVA Air?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Vancouver to Sapporo are ANA and EVA Air. With an average price for the route of C$ 1,161 and an overall rating of 8.4, ANA is the most popular choice. EVA Air is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of C$ 1,615 and an overall rating of 8.4.
